# spark_study_47 **Repository Path**: cwflink/spark_study_47 ## Basic Information - **Project Name**: spark_study_47 - **Description**: sparkstreaming+direct模式kafka+mysql - **Primary Language**: Scala - **License**: Not specified - **Default Branch**: master - **Homepage**: None - **GVP Project**: No ## Statistics - **Stars**: 0 - **Forks**: 3 - **Created**: 2021-06-06 - **Last Updated**: 2021-06-06 ## Categories & Tags **Categories**: Uncategorized **Tags**: None ## README # 网盘项目 1.码云地址: https://gitee.com/liminghui321/webdisk/tree/devlop 2.项目架构 开发工具:IDEA 构建工具:Maven 后端框架springBoot+mybatis 前端使用 layui+Jquery 3.实现功能: 1.单文件的上传下载 2.github的OAuth认证 3.新建文件夹,文件重命名,删除文件等功能 4.利用MD5的实现相同文件的简单秒传 5.文件夹的上下级跳转 20201107修复 注意事项: 1.注意回调url和github配置必须一致 https://docs.github.com/en/free-pro-team@latest/developers/apps/authorizing-oauth-apps 2.用策略模式+反射+枚举减少if else,解耦 3.使用springboot上下文获取对象 T t = (T) SpringContextUtils.getBean(clazz); 4.注意基本类型比较用==;引用类型用equals 5. 解决静态方法注入 折中赋值 @PostConstruct 6.集成日志框架,sl4j2 20210107 1.mybatis的sql语句修改到xml中方便后期维护